Question 141347: A plane is flying the 3,458 mile trip from New York City to London has a 50 MPH tailwind. The flight's Point of No Return is the point at which the flight time required to return to New York is the same a the time required to continue to London. If the speed on the plane in still air is 360 MPH, how far is New York from the point of no return?

From the given information we can say:
360 + 50 = 410 mph speed (relative to the earth) with the wind
360 - 50 - 310 mph speed against the wind
:
Let d = dist to New York from point of no return
Then
(3458-d) = dist to London from point of no return
:
Write a time equation: Time = dist/speed
:
Return to N.Y time = Continue to London time
=
Cross multiply:
410d = 310(3458-d)
:
410d = 1071980 - 310d
:
410d + 310d = 1071980
:
720d = 1071980
d =
d = 1488.86 mi from N.Y.
:
:
Check solution by finding the distance to London and calculating the time to both:
3458 - 1488.86 = 1969.14 mi to London
:
Time to N.Y.: 1488.86/310 = 4.8 hrs
Time to Lond: 1969.14/410 = 4.8 hrs
